He wasn't quite sure what he was expecting, but he was still surprised by the polite manner in which the cat spoke. It stunned him into silence for several heart beats, before he was able to shake himself to his senses. He couldn't recall the last time that he had been called sir, if ever at all. Licking at his lips, he slowly nodded his head, letting his gaze roam to the icy lake. He had seen what happened when the ice was stepped on, the eruption of blue that bloomed beneath his paws. It was beautiful, and something that he wanted to see over and over again. "I am. Much more comfortable than the summer heat," Lyulf said slowly, chewing over his words carefully. He didn't miss the wary glance of the lynx, mirroring his own feelings. He hadn't had much interaction with his own species, let alone others. An ember of curiosity burned in him, enough that he took a few more steps towards the cat. "I'm Lyulf." He remembered that introductions were a thing, sparing him some of the awkwardness of forgetting, unlike the last run in that he had had.

A few more steps were taken, eyes lifting from the feline to the lake once more, tracing the arches of ice that seemed to burst forth from the frozen lake. "Have you stepped on the ice yet?" He asked, his words flowing a little more freely now that he had been speaking for a little bit. The tension in his shoulders started to ease, although his limbs were locked and ready to flee if he needed to. It was nice to have someone to talk to on this night, and for some reason he felt far more comfortable with this lynx than he did another wolf. It was hard to understand exactly why, but it didn't tug on his scarred heart like his own kind did. A lifted sigh left his lips, ease returning to his once pinched expression. He even managed a hint of a smile, inclining his head towards the surface of the lake as if she should watch him. Moving to her side, keeping a number of feet between them just in case, he reached out and pressed his pad into the surface of ice. At the pressure, blue lights exploded under his touch, twisting around his paw until they faded and died away. Briefly his mostly pale toned coat was outlined in the wonderful blues that the bio-luminescence cast on him. Lyulf's smile grew a bit, lifting his eyes to peek at the lynx in wonderment.
